<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<html>
<head>
<meta content="text/html; charset=ISO-8859-1"
http-equiv="Content-Type">
</head>
<body bgcolor="#ffffff" text="#000000">
Hallo Sebastian,<br>
<br>
Am 19.04.2010 21:10, schrieb Sebastian Kösters:
<blockquote cite="mid:008d01cadff4$0a62c5a0$1f2850e0$@de" type="cite">
<pre wrap="">PS: ich hab jetzt spasseshalber mal
/mail/domain.net/skoesters//Maildir angelegt.
Und schon geht logtechnisch alles (Mails kann ich jedoch nicht mit meinem
Mailclient aufrufen).
</pre>
</blockquote>
Welche Ferhlermeldung kommt dazu? Dovecot muss das Dir anlegen,
vorausgesetzt das AUTH <br>
klappt korrekt und er hat die Infos die er dazu braucht.<br>
<br>
<blockquote cite="mid:008d01cadff4$0a62c5a0$1f2850e0$@de" type="cite">
<pre wrap="">leider ändert das auch nichts. Hab den Ordner verschoben und deine
Ergänzungen benutzt.
</pre>
</blockquote>
Interessant wäre gewesen was er Dir dann für ein Verzeichnis anlegt.
Also ist da Rechtetechnisch was nicht in Ordnung.<br>
<br>
<blockquote cite="mid:008d01cadff4$0a62c5a0$1f2850e0$@de" type="cite">
<pre wrap="">
Den Ordner Mail hab ich erstellt, darunter erstellt dovecot jedoch keine
weiteren Ordner. </pre>
</blockquote>
Komisch.<br>
<br>
Warum willst Du denn die UID=8 und GID=12 haben? Sollen alle User
unterschiedliche UIDs/GIDs haben bei sir? Siehe:<br>
<pre wrap="">> deliver(<a class="moz-txt-link-abbreviated" href="mailto:skoesters@domain.net">skoesters@domain.net</a>): Apr 19 20:48:27 Info: auth input: <font
color="#ff0000">uid=8</font>
> deliver(<a class="moz-txt-link-abbreviated" href="mailto:skoesters@domain.net">skoesters@domain.net</a>): Apr 19 20:48:27 Info: auth input: <font
color="#ff0000">gid=12</font></pre>
<br>
<blockquote cite="mid:00fd01cadfba$6c816190$458424b0$@de" type="cite">
<pre wrap="">---
Dovecot-mysql.conf
---
connect = host=192.168.2.200 port=3306 user=postfix password=xxxxx
dbname=postfix
driver = mysql
default_pass_scheme = PLAIN-MD5
password_query = SELECT password,CONCAT('<i class="moz-txt-slash"><span
class="moz-txt-tag">/</span>mail<span class="moz-txt-tag">/</span></i>', maildir) AS userdb_home,
'8' AS userdb_uid, '12' AS userdb_gid, NULL as allow_nets FROM mailbox WHERE
username = '%u' AND domain = '%d' AND active = '1'
user_query = SELECT CONCAT('<i class="moz-txt-slash"><span
class="moz-txt-tag">/</span>mail<span class="moz-txt-tag">/</span></i>', maildir) AS home, '' as mail, '8' AS
uid, '12' AS gid, mailbox.quota AS quota FROM mailbox WHERE username = '%u'
AND domain = '%d'
</pre>
</blockquote>
<br>
Warum hantierst Du da mit CONCAT rum und setzt UID etc. im MYSQL query?
Brauchst Du für jeden <br>
User andere IDs im System? SInd doch virtuelle Domains, da kannst Du
alles auf eine ID legen der <br>
einfachkeit halber.<br>
<br>
Stell mal in der dovecot.conf folgende Parameter ein:<br>
<br>
auth_verbose=yes <br>
auth_debug_passwords=yes<br>
mail_debug=yes <br>
log_path = /var/log/dovecot.log<br>
info_log_path = /var/log/dovecot_info.log<br>
log_timestamp = "%b %d %H:%M:%S "<br>
syslog_facility = mail<br>
<br>
Und teste den login, damit Du weisst warum der Client nix abholen kann.<br>
<br>
Ich habe dieses Tutorial für postfix/dovecot verwendet als Grundlage, <br>
damit rennts bei mir unter CentOS-5.4(final) prima.<br>
<br>
<a class="moz-txt-link-freetext" href="http://workaround.org/ispmail/lenny/">http://workaround.org/ispmail/lenny/</a><br>
<br>
Ich weiss solche tuts sind nicht immer ratsahm, aber wenn Du das an
Dein System anpasst (postfix/dovecot/MySQL Tables etc.) <br>
dann hast Du eine gute Grundlage und kannst
virtual_alias_maps/virtual_mailbox_domains und virtual_mailbox_maps
prima<br>
mit dovectos SASL auth und dovecot als delivery agent nutzen. Speziell
die master.cf sieht bei mir auch anders aus:<br>
<br>
dovecot unix - n n - - pipe<br>
flags=DRhu user=vmail:vmail argv=/usr/libexec/dovecot/deliver -d
${recipient}<br>
<br>
Gruß<br>
Marcel<br>
<br>
<pre class="moz-signature" cols="72">--
Marcel Hartmann (webdeveloper && project manager)
<a class="moz-txt-link-abbreviated" href="mailto:mail@marcel-hartmann.com">mail@marcel-hartmann.com</a> // <a class="moz-txt-link-abbreviated" href="http://www.marcel-hartmann.com">www.marcel-hartmann.com</a></pre>
</body>
</html>